Answer: '<em>Once upon a midnight dreary'</em> and '<em>Ah, distinctly I remember it was in the bleak December' </em>help establish the setting.

Explanation:

The setting is a literary element that provides us with the information about the time and/or place in which a particular story happens.

In Edgar Allan Poe's <em>The Raven,</em> the setting is explained in the first line of the poem, where the narrator tells us that the story takes place at night (around midnight). Moreover, the word <em>'dreary'</em> indicates that the atmosphere is depressing.

In the following line: <em>'Ah, distinctly I remember it was in the bleak December', </em>the narrator provides more information by telling us that the event that he is about to describe took place in December.
